英文摘要:
      With the continuous penetration of renewable energy, the management of micro-grid shows complexity and diversity. The development of efficient scheduling strategy can not only reduce the burden of the large grid, but also achieve mutual benefit and win-win situation.This paper focuses on such a micro-grid with a wind generator,a photovoltaic system, a diesel generator and an energy storing device.In the case of incorporating the external power grid, the interactive potential between the user side and the micro-grid is maximized, and the optimal scheduling strategy is coordinated between the outputs of each micro power source.Finally, according to the proposed evaluation indexes, each optimal scheduling strategy is evaluated.The effectiveness and rationality of the proposed scheduling strategy are verified by simulation and calculation of evaluation indexes.
